My Apocalypse Territory Chapter 85

"The assessment of the Patrol Team is set for tomorrow. As for today, let's finish up the remaining tasks now." Tang Yu counted the issues still needing resolution on his fingers. He had agreed to be a hands-off Lord, but he ended up as busy as a dog. The development of the Territory was gradually getting on track, and various systems were becoming more comprehensive, resulting in him signing nearly half an hour's worth of documents. Including the acquisition and distribution of resources, survivor statistics, personnel changes, and the recent recruitment for the Patrol Team, and so on. As the director of the Sanctuary, he couldn't be ignorant of these matters. "But these are still manageable..." Tang Yu just glanced over them; Chen Haiping and Luo Zhe handled the details. Some things, however, needed his personal attention. "The recruitment for the Patrol Team means that the Sanctuary's firearms might not suffice. The workshop could only produce bullets before, but luckily, we downloaded quite a few firearms blueprints in Lindong, stored on a USB drive. Just take it to the research institute, and with a small amount of Source Crystals, we should be able to convert them into models that the workshop can produce..." "And that Awakening Potion, the research institute should also be able to deduce the production formula from the finished product. However, this consumption might be quite large, so the deduction of the potion formula can be postponed for now." There's another thing. Compared to Lindong Sanctuary, our Territory's external information channels are still too limited. If it weren't for this trip to Lindong Sanctuary, he would have had no idea about the changes in the outside world... Having this system and this Territory, there's infinite potential for development, but he would not underestimate human intelligence, especially in a disaster. Either you are devoured by the disaster or you rise from it. "We need to establish an intelligence agency, focusing on information collection not just around the Territory but from Lindong. This agency will acquire information from Lindong and report back to the Territory, giving us a stable channel to understand the outside world." This plan was feasible, and he already had someone in mind. Tang Yu, with Number One, his supreme bodyguard, left the holiday villa. As he walked, he observed the terrain and soon sketched out a simple map. It might be a little ugly—after all, Lord Tang's talent didn't lie in drawing—but that wasn't important. What Tang Yu wanted to know wasn't the map itself, but rather how much the Territory had expanded after the upgrade. Whether through the Territory map or the Crystal Ball, taking a personal tour was ultimately more illuminating. And to build some Arrow Towers along the periphery. These, too, he came to the site to construct rather than controlling remotely. Tang Yu had experimented before, building structures remotely uses up more mental energy. He hadn't forgotten that time when, in order to build a wall, he almost drained himself. Now, his control over the Territory had deepened, and the mental strain during construction was less. Even if he was in Lindong, controlling the rise of buildings wasn't impossible; Tang Yu just thought it's better not to push his luck. So he came to the site in person. Selecting the right spot, he pointed, and chunks of Stone emerged from the Void, solidifying in an instant to form a ten-meter-tall Arrow Tower. Such Arrow Towers, distributed in a semi-circle around the holiday villa, amounted to six that Tang Yu built. "With these, there won't be any more trouble from Demonized Beasts within the range of the holiday villa, and we can better proceed with peripheral construction." Anyway, building a wall was out of the question—there wasn't enough Stone. Only by constructing defensive buildings could we maintain those relatively safe days. As for the Demon Tide... well, there's still a small wall, which should be sufficient. Having dealt with these, what remained to be built was the Energy Patio. "Although this thing can supply energy wherever it's built, it's still a very valuable structure and needs to be placed somewhere safe." In the castle, within Eileen's room. Winnie was changing her clothes. When she was first summoned, she had been somewhat bewildered and did not want to keep Lord waiting for too long, so she hastily changed into a set of clothes and went to meet with the Lord. As a result, the clothes were too tight, and she did not feel comfortable wearing them. Eileen took out a seemingly larger piece of clothing from the wardrobe for Winnie to change into. Even though it was quite a loose-fitting top, it seemed to take on the meaning of a tight shirt once on her, as if it were ready to burst forth. Eileen looked on with a bit of envy, but Winnie's face showed some distress. She asked, "Is it still too tight?" Winnie tugged at the clothing and shook her head, "The clothes are fine, it's just that, that chest-binding thing, it still feels too tight." She was very frustrated because even wearing the largest size for a short duration was manageable, but after a while, it still became uncomfortable. "How about we forget it, then? I won't wear it; I never wore such things before." "Hmm…" Eileen pondered. "We could go to the Lord and see if there's suitable clothing and if we can't find any, we could have the Lord custom-make some." "That sort of thing would be too much to trouble the Lord with," Winnie said, shaking her head. As a follower, one should be handling affairs for the Lord, not bringing every problem to him, especially of this sort. She found it even harder to speak up about it. She felt it was fine just to wear it as it was. Suddenly, her gaze flitted, "Eh, isn't that the Lord?" Eileen's room was on the fifth floor of the castle, which just so happened to have a view of the garden below. After an upgrade, the garden in front of the castle had gotten bigger with flowers of various colors blooming profusely, gently swaying in the breeze. They saw Tang Yu walking on the garden path, looking around curiously. "Does the Lord also enjoy flower-viewing?" Winnie stood by the window, looking down at the garden below. "I'm not sure about that," said Eileen, joining her curiosity at the window, "but the Lord is very approachable without those noble airs. He will definitely help you with the clothing issue." In the midst of their conversation, they saw Tang Yu coming to a halt, extending his right hand. The ground before him suddenly dipped, and around the hollow, giant oval stones rose from the earth, one after the other, forming uneven stone columns that enclosed the entire pit. Then, mystical runes lit up on those stones, slowly extending to the bottom of the pit. As if carried by a spiraling air, clearly visible to the naked eye, a pool of azure water appeared out of nowhere at the bottom of the pit, quickly filling and rising until it reached a certain height before stopping. In an instant, an invisible fluctuation spread outwards from the Energy Patio at the core, radiating westward around it. Tang Yu's hair was slightly lifted by the breath of air. In the garden, many buds blossomed at that moment, splendid and breathtaking, as if opening their arms to embrace the world. The grass and trees grew, the young branches sprouted—not like the wild weeds growing wildly in the fields, but as if watered with the essence of life, making these flowers and plants come alive. Vivid flowers, tender green shoots, swaying with the breeze. Surrounding the figure standing amid the sea of flowers.
